Output 54d656f939a5683ccf7fe811d0ca558beb4917a4b6af675e7644c947d3965865:1

value
45945658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d7643580e38d4b868cbacfdee04e3e939a8ca4b OP_EQUAL
address
MSdYRpLpNmF2tG4fntzqz88b1o6hEDvNpt
transaction
54d656f939a5683ccf7fe811d0ca558beb4917a4b6af675e7644c947d3965865
spent
true